docker run :创建一个新的容器并运行一个命令 以下为docker run时可以加的一些参数 二、docker run指令的参数 1. -d 后台运行容器,并返回容器ID,此时不会进入交互界面,如果想要进入交互界面请加-i和-t参数。 如果用了-d参数未进入容器的时候,在想进入容器,指令:docker exec -it 容器名称 /bin/bash; 2. -...
使用run 命令创建容器 docker run -p 81:80 --name nginx1 -d nginx:1.18.0 -p 81:80 : 将容器中的80端口,映射到宿主机81端口 --name nginx1 : 指定容器名称为 nginx1 -d : 创建后 容器在后台运行,并打印容器的id nginx:1.18.0 : 指明运行的镜像 image.png 使用curl 127.0.0.1:81 查看81端口 ...
docker run -d -p 8888:8080 —name tomcat_muller tomcat:7这个命令将在后台模式(通过-d选项)下运行一个名为tomcat_muller的容器,并将容器的8080端口映射到主机的8888端口。容器的镜像是tomcat:7。通过-d参数创建容器,不影响我们运行其他命令。使用镜像tomcat:7以后台模式启动一个容器将容器的8080端口映射到主机...
docker run -d --name jenkin_hogwarts --privileged=true jenkins/jenkins # 进入容器 docker exec -it jenkin_hogwarts bash 总结 docker run是 Docker 中一个非常强大和常用的命令,可以根据指定的镜像创建和启动容器。通过合理地使用选项,你可以配置容器的各种属性,包括后台运行、端口映射、挂载卷等。希望本文的介...
-d如果在docker run后面追加-d=true或者-d,那么容器将会运行在后台模式。 此时所有I/O数据只能通过网络资源或者共享卷组来进行交互。因为容器不再监听你执行docker run的这个终端命令行窗口。但你可以通过执行docker attach来重新附着到该容器的回话中。 需要注意的是,容器运行在后台模式下,是不能使用--rm选项的。
以微秒为单位限制CPU实时运行时间 --cpu-shares , -c CPU份额(相对权重) --cpus API 1.25+ CPU数量 --cpuset-cpus 允许执行的CPU(0-3,0,1) --cpuset-mems 允许执行的MEM(0-3,0,1) --detach , -d 在后台运行容器并打印容器ID --detach-keys 覆盖用于分离容器的键序列 ...
docker run -d --name dashu-nginx -p 6060:80 nginx:1.25.4 给大家解释一下,各参数的意思 (1) -d 表示 后台运行 (2) --name 表示给容器起一个名字 (3) -p 端口映射 这块详细的可以参考这篇文章 (4) 最后跟上镜像的名称:版本 启动后我们访问一下 我们的nginx: ...
如果在docker run 后面追加-d=true或者-d,则containter将会运行在后台模式(Detached mode)。此时所有I/O数据只能通过网络资源或者共享卷组来进行交互。因为container不再监听你执行docker run的这个终端命令行窗口。但你可以通过执行docker attach 来重新挂载这个container里面。需要注意的时,如果你选择执行-d使container进...
https://www.runoob.com/docker/docker-run-command.html -i:打开STDIN,用于控制台交互。 -d:容器在后台运行。 -p:指定端口映射。 --restart:本参数用于指定在容器退出时,是否重启容器。 -v:本参数用于指定容器卷。 -t:分配虚
docker run -d: 后台运行容器,并返回容器ID 不过Docker容器在后台运行,必须要有一个前台进程,这里我们让容器有前台程序运行,就可以实现容器的-d 启动后存活。 即便是有进程在后台运行,你进入了容器,输入exit退出,依然会终止容器的运行。 到此,关于“退出docker容器的命令是什么”的学习就结束了,希望能够解决大家的...